Sourcing guidance for Sequin Dress

What are the key technical specifications to consider when sourcing high-quality sequin dresses?

When evaluating sequin dresses, focus on the base fabric density (typically mesh or polyester) to ensure it can support the weight of the embellishments without sagging. The sequin attachment method is critical; lock-stitched sequins are superior to glued ones as they prevent shedding. Additionally, check for a full inner lining (usually soft jersey or satin) to ensure wearer comfort and prevent the sequins from irritating the skin.

How can I verify the quality and durability of the sequins and embroidery?

Request a colorfastness test report to ensure the sequins do not lose their metallic or iridescent coating when exposed to friction or cleaning agents. Conduct a 'shake test' on samples to check for loose threads. For high-end markets, prioritize 3mm to 5mm PET sequins which are more heat-resistant and eco-friendly compared to PVC alternatives.

What compliance standards are mandatory for exporting sequin dresses to international markets?

For the US market, products must comply with ASTM D1230 for flammability of apparel textiles. For the EU, ensure the dyes and materials meet REACH regulations, specifically regarding azo dyes and lead content in metallic coatings. If sourcing children's sequin dresses, strict adherence to CPSIA (US) or EN 71 (EU) regarding small parts (choking hazards) is mandatory.

What are the common usage scenarios and design trends for sequin dresses in the B2B sector?

Sequin dresses are primarily sourced for evening wear, bridal parties, prom seasons, and performance costumes. Current trends include reversible 'mermaid' sequins, ombre color gradients, and sustainable sequins made from recycled plastics. Cross-Border Procurement & Risk Management for Sequin Apparel

What are the specific risks associated with shipping sequin dresses internationally?

The primary risk is snagging and compression damage. Ensure the supplier uses individual polybags for each garment and includes acid-free tissue paper between folds to prevent sequins from interlocking. For bulk shipments, use reinforced corrugated boxes to prevent crushing, which can crease the sequins permanently.

How should I negotiate MOQs and lead times with Chinese garment manufacturers?

Sequin fabric production is labor-intensive. Standard lead times range from 25 to 45 days. When negotiating, offer a staggered delivery schedule for large orders to reduce pressure on the supplier's QC line. For new designs, start with a sample order (typically $50-$150) to verify the 'hand-feel' and fit before committing to a full production run.

How can I optimize shipping costs for high-volume sequin dress orders?

Since sequin dresses are relatively heavy, Sea Freight (LCL) is the most cost-effective for large volumes. However, for seasonal launches (e.g., New Year's Eve collections), Air Freight may be necessary. Work with a freight forwarder to calculate the volumetric weight vs. actual weight, as bulky evening gowns can incur higher costs if not vacuum-packed efficiently.
